David Roberts, Digger La Rue and eight other progressive East Van yachtsmen met aboard their new yacht "December Dreams ",during the afternoon of Tuesday, July 30, 2002. DD was anchored off Portside Park at the foot of Main Street. They proposed forming a club among East Van businessmen and residents, which could serve as an organization for weekend East Van Harbor racing, summer cruises in the co

oler English Bay waters and generally just Giviner. Melanie terBorg was the first woman to join the RNYYC; the year was 2005, and it was not all smooth sailing. Much debate was heard in the board room and echoed in the East End Times that wrote, "...Legal lore scintillated across the room. Eloquence leaped skyward in volumes. Seen and unseen reefs were talked of, and the reverse of smooth water, fair tides, winds abaft the beam and sunshine for the old club were thought to be as Neptune lives, if the constitution was so construed." The nays had it at first, but within a couple of minutes the tide turned with an amendment. Melanie terBorg was elected with her new steam yacht, "Seaduced", usually moored at Dusty Greenwell Park, East Van's northern most point, not too big and predominately peopled by Carnies. She had often entertained REVYC members there, which no doubt helped her application.
